@import"https://fonts.googleapis.com/css2?family=Poppins:wght@300;400;500;600;700&display=swap";*{font-family:Poppins,sans-serif!important}::-webkit-scrollbar{width:4px;height:4px}::-webkit-scrollbar-track{background:transparent}::-webkit-scrollbar-thumb{background:var(--Principal-Encode-Green);border-radius:12px}::-webkit-scrollbar-thumb:hover{background:var(--Principal-Encode-Green)}*{scrollbar-width:thin;scrollbar-color:var(--Principal-Encode-Green) transparent}html,body,#root{height:100%;margin:0}:root{--Principal-Black: #29292A;--Secondary-Blue: #206FCB;--Transparents-Blue-5: rgba(32, 111, 203, .05);--Secondary-Green: #9EBD8F;--Secondary-Red: #FB035C;--Main-Background: #FCF9F9;--Principal-White: #FCF9F9;--Principal-Encode-Green: #308196;--Principal-Light-Blue: #B9E3EF;--Green-Dark-400: #266778;--Green-Dark-500: #1D4D5A;--Green-Dark-600: #13343C;--Secondary-New-Yellow: #FFF52E;--Transparents-Yellow-8: rgba(255, 245, 46, .08);--Green-Light-50: #D0E9F0;--Green-Light-100: #A0D4E1;--Green-Light-200: #71BED2;--Green-Light-300: #42A8C2;--100: #FFF;--150: #FCF9F9;--200: #E8E8E8;--300: #D2D2D2;--500: #A4A4A4;--400: #BBB;--600: #8E8E8E;--700: #7D7D7D;--800: #5B5B5B;--900: #4A4A4A;--1000: #29292A;--1100: #1A1919;--supplier-login-gradient: linear-gradient(126deg, #FDFEFF 10.8%, #E3EFF2 78.48%)}.disabled-button{opacity:.6}.clickable{cursor:pointer}.column{display:flex;flex-direction:column}.input{flex-grow:1;background-color:transparent;color:var(--1100);padding-left:12px;box-sizing:border-box;border:none}.input::placeholder{color:var(--500);opacity:1}.input:focus{outline:none;box-shadow:none}.input-wrapper{display:flex;width:347px;align-items:center;border:1px solid var(--500);border-radius:8px;height:42px;background-color:var(--150);box-sizing:border-box}.body-small{text-align:center;font-family:Poppins,serif;font-size:12px;font-style:normal;font-weight:400;line-height:24px}.body-medium{font-family:Poppins,serif;font-size:14px;font-style:normal;font-weight:400;line-height:22px}.title-small{font-family:Poppins,serif;font-size:16px;font-style:normal;font-weight:700;line-height:22.862px}.title-big,.heading-xl{font-family:Poppins,serif;font-size:32px;font-style:normal;font-weight:600;line-height:40px}.form-description{font-family:Poppins,serif;font-size:14px;font-style:normal;font-weight:400;line-height:24px}.button-xl{font-family:Poppins,serif;font-size:16px;font-style:normal;font-weight:600;line-height:25px;text-align:center}.heading-h3-semibold{font-family:Poppins,serif;font-size:24px;font-style:normal;font-weight:600;line-height:40px}.heading-l-medium{font-family:Poppins,serif;font-size:32px;font-style:normal;font-weight:500;line-height:40px}.heading-h1-xxl-semi{font-family:Poppins,serif;font-size:32px;font-style:normal;font-weight:600;line-height:40px}.heading-h1-xxl-bold{font-family:Poppins,serif;font-size:32px;font-style:normal;font-weight:700;line-height:40px}.heading-h2-xl-semibold{font-family:Poppins,serif;font-size:28px;font-style:normal;font-weight:600;line-height:40px}.body-s-regular{font-family:Poppins,serif;font-size:14px;font-style:normal;font-weight:400;line-height:22px}.body-xs-regular{font-family:Poppins,serif;font-size:12px;font-style:normal;font-weight:400;line-height:14px}.body-s-semibold{font-family:Poppins,serif;font-weight:600;font-size:14px;line-height:22px;letter-spacing:0}.caption-xs{font-family:Poppins,serif;font-size:12px;font-style:normal;font-weight:400;line-height:16px}.body-m-semibold{font-family:Poppins,serif;font-weight:600;font-size:16px;line-height:24px}.body-m-uppercase{font-family:Poppins,serif;font-size:12px;font-style:normal;font-weight:500;line-height:24px;text-transform:uppercase}.body-l-bold{font-family:Poppins,serif;font-size:18px;font-style:normal;font-weight:700;line-height:24px}.body-l-semibold{font-family:Poppins,serif;font-size:18px;font-style:normal;font-weight:600;line-height:24px}.body-l-regular{font-family:Poppins,serif;font-size:18px;font-style:normal;font-weight:400;line-height:24px}.body-m-medium{font-family:Poppins,serif;font-size:16px;font-style:normal;font-weight:500;line-height:24px}.body-m-regular{font-family:Poppins,serif;font-size:16px;font-style:normal;font-weight:400;line-height:24px}.body-m-bold{font-family:Poppins,serif;font-size:16px;font-style:normal;font-weight:700;line-height:22.862px}.underline{text-decoration-line:underline;text-decoration-style:solid;text-decoration-skip-ink:none;text-decoration-thickness:auto;text-underline-offset:auto;text-underline-position:from-font}._100{color:var(--100)}._300{color:var(--300)}._500{color:var(--500)}._600{color:var(--600)}._700{color:var(--700)}._800{color:var(--800)}._900{color:var(--900)}._1000{color:var(--1000)}._1100{color:var(--1100)}._Secondary-Red{color:var(--Secondary-Red)}._Secondary-Blue{color:var(--Secondary-Blue)}._Principal_Encode_Green{color:var(--Principal-Encode-Green)}._Principal_White{color:var(--Principal-White)}._Principal_Black{color:var(--Principal-Black)}.pointer{cursor:pointer}.text-align-center{text-align:center}.fit-icon{display:flex;align-items:center;justify-content:center}.login-form{width:471px;max-width:100%;display:flex;flex-direction:column;gap:40px}.login-form-header{display:flex;flex-direction:column;gap:4px}.login-form-header h2,.login-form-header p{margin:0}.login-form-fields{display:flex;flex-direction:column;gap:8px}.login-form-inputs{display:flex;flex-direction:column;gap:20px}.login-password-toggle{display:flex;align-items:center;justify-content:center;padding:0;border:none;background:transparent;color:var(--600);cursor:pointer}.login-form-row{display:flex;justify-content:flex-end;align-items:center;margin-top:4px}.login-form-actions{display:flex;flex-direction:column;gap:20px}.login-form-footer{display:flex;flex-direction:column;gap:12px}.login-form-footer p{margin:0}.encode-button{box-sizing:border-box;background-color:var(--Green-Dark-400);color:var(--100);border-radius:10px!important;border:none;padding:12px 0!important;width:100%;text-align:center!important;transition:all .2s ease-in-out!important;height:50px;display:flex;align-items:center;justify-content:center}.encode-button:hover{background-color:var(--Green-Dark-500);box-shadow:none}.encode-button.disabled-button{background-color:#a5a5a5!important;color:#e0e0e0;cursor:not-allowed;box-shadow:none}.auth-page{display:flex;flex-direction:row;height:100%;width:100%;box-sizing:border-box}.auth-aside{flex:1;background-color:var(--Green-Dark-500);box-sizing:border-box;padding:50px 85px;display:flex;flex-direction:column;justify-content:space-between;gap:40px;overflow-y:auto}.auth-aside-top{display:flex;flex-direction:column;gap:12px}.auth-aside-logo{width:193px;height:55px;object-fit:contain;align-self:flex-start}.auth-aside-divider{height:1px;width:100%;background-color:#fff3}.auth-aside-portal{font-family:Poppins,sans-serif;font-size:24px;font-weight:400;line-height:40px;color:var(--600)}.auth-aside-middle{display:flex;flex-direction:column;gap:60px;max-width:471px}.auth-aside-pitch{display:flex;flex-direction:column;gap:20px}.auth-aside-pitch h1{margin:0}.auth-aside-subtitle{margin:0;font-family:Poppins,sans-serif;font-size:24px;font-weight:400;line-height:40px;color:var(--600)}.auth-aside-bullets{list-style:none;margin:0;padding:0;display:flex;flex-direction:column;gap:18px}.auth-aside-bullet{display:flex;align-items:center;gap:12px}.auth-aside-bullet-dot{flex-shrink:0;width:6px;height:6px;border-radius:50%;background-color:var(--Principal-Encode-Green)}.auth-aside-footer{margin:0}.auth-main{flex:1;background:var(--supplier-login-gradient);display:flex;align-items:center;justify-content:center;box-sizing:border-box;padding:40px;overflow-y:auto}@media(max-width:900px){.auth-page{flex-direction:column;height:auto;min-height:100%}.auth-aside,.auth-main{flex:none;width:100%}.auth-aside{padding:40px}}.auth-field{display:flex;flex-direction:column;gap:8px}.auth-input-wrapper{display:flex;align-items:center;gap:8px;height:50px;padding:12px 16px;box-sizing:border-box;background-color:var(--100);border:1px solid var(--300);border-radius:10px;transition:border-color .15s ease-in-out}.auth-input-wrapper:focus-within{border-color:var(--Principal-Encode-Green)}.auth-input{flex:1;min-width:0;border:none;outline:none;background:transparent;color:var(--1100)}.auth-input::placeholder{color:var(--300);opacity:1}.generic-loader-page-main{display:flex;align-items:center;justify-content:center;height:100%;width:100%}.supplier-home{display:flex;flex-direction:column;gap:8px;padding:40px 48px}.supplier-home h1,.supplier-home p{margin:0}.forgot-form{width:471px;max-width:100%;display:flex;flex-direction:column;gap:32px}.forgot-form-header{display:flex;flex-direction:column;gap:4px}.forgot-form-header h2,.forgot-form-header p{margin:0}.forgot-form-actions{display:flex;flex-direction:column;gap:16px}.forgot-form-back{margin:0;text-align:center}.supplier-shell{display:flex;height:100%}.supplier-sidebar{width:260px;min-width:260px;background:var(--Green-Dark-600);display:flex;flex-direction:column;color:var(--100)}.supplier-sidebar-brand{padding:20px 24px;border-bottom:1px solid var(--800)}.supplier-brand-name{margin:0;font-size:20px;font-weight:600;line-height:28px;color:var(--100);word-break:break-word}.supplier-brand-sub{margin:2px 0 0;font-size:14px;line-height:20px;color:var(--600)}.supplier-nav{display:flex;flex-direction:column;gap:8px;padding:20px 24px;flex:1;overflow-y:auto}.supplier-nav-item{display:flex;align-items:center;height:32px;padding:4px 12px;border:none;border-radius:8px;background:transparent;color:var(--600);text-align:left;cursor:pointer;transition:background-color .15s ease,color .15s ease}.supplier-nav-item:not(.supplier-nav-item-disabled):not(.supplier-nav-item-active):hover{background:#ffffff0f;color:var(--300)}.supplier-nav-item-active{background:var(--Principal-Encode-Green);color:var(--100)}.supplier-nav-item-disabled{color:var(--800);cursor:not-allowed}.supplier-sidebar-footer{border-top:1px solid var(--800);padding:20px 24px;display:flex;flex-direction:column;gap:12px}.supplier-user{display:flex;gap:12px;align-items:center}.supplier-avatar{width:36px;height:36px;min-width:36px;border-radius:50%;background:var(--Green-Dark-400);color:var(--100);display:flex;align-items:center;justify-content:center}.supplier-user-info{display:flex;flex-direction:column;min-width:0}.supplier-user-name{margin:0;color:var(--100);white-space:nowrap;overflow:hidden;text-overflow:ellipsis}.supplier-user-role{margin:0;font-size:12px;font-weight:300;line-height:18px;color:var(--500)}.supplier-logout{background:transparent;border:1px solid var(--800);color:var(--300);border-radius:8px;padding:8px;cursor:pointer;transition:background-color .15s ease}.supplier-logout:hover{background:#ffffff0f}.supplier-content{flex:1;min-width:0;height:100%;overflow:auto;background:var(--Main-Background)}.proc-page{display:flex;flex-direction:column;padding:20px 26px;gap:16px;box-sizing:border-box}.proc-header{display:flex;flex-direction:column}.proc-title{margin:0;font-size:18px;font-weight:700;line-height:24px;color:var(--800)}.proc-subtitle{margin:2px 0 0;color:var(--600)}.proc-banner{display:flex;align-items:center;gap:12px;height:46px;padding:0 17px;border:1px solid var(--Secondary-New-Yellow);background:var(--Transparents-Yellow-8);border-radius:10px;color:var(--900)}.proc-banner-dot{width:8px;height:8px;min-width:8px;border-radius:50%;background:var(--Secondary-New-Yellow)}.proc-toolbar{display:flex;align-items:center;justify-content:space-between;gap:20px;flex-wrap:wrap}.proc-tabs{display:flex;align-items:center;gap:12px}.proc-tab{height:38px;padding:0 18px;border:1px solid var(--200);border-radius:12px;background:var(--150);color:var(--400);cursor:pointer;transition:background-color .15s ease,color .15s ease}.proc-tab:hover:not(.proc-tab-active){color:var(--700)}.proc-tab-active{background:#206fcb1f;border-color:#206fcb4d;color:var(--Secondary-Blue)}.proc-search{display:flex;align-items:center;gap:9px;height:38px;width:386px;max-width:100%;padding:0 12px;border:1px solid var(--200);border-radius:12px;background:var(--150);box-sizing:border-box}.proc-search-icon{flex-shrink:0;width:16px;height:16px;fill:var(--400)}.proc-search-input{flex:1;min-width:0;border:none;background:transparent;color:var(--1100);outline:none}.proc-search-input::placeholder{color:var(--400)}.proc-body{display:flex;align-items:stretch;gap:20px}.proc-main{flex:1;min-width:0;display:flex;flex-direction:column;gap:16px}.proc-table{position:relative;display:flex;flex-direction:column;border-radius:4px}.proc-loader-bar{position:absolute;top:52px;left:0;height:2px;width:100%;background:linear-gradient(to right,transparent,var(--Secondary-Blue),transparent);background-size:200% 100%;animation:procMoveGradient 1.4s linear infinite;z-index:1}@keyframes procMoveGradient{0%{background-position:200% 0}to{background-position:-200% 0}}.proc-table-head{display:flex;align-items:center;gap:20px;padding:16px 38px;background:#7d7d7d1a;border-radius:4px;color:var(--700)}.proc-table-body{display:flex;flex-direction:column}.proc-row{display:flex;align-items:center;gap:20px;padding:12px 18px;border-bottom:1px solid var(--200);cursor:pointer}.proc-row:hover{background:#206fcb0a}.proc-row-selected,.proc-row-selected:hover{background:var(--Transparents-Blue-5)}.proc-row-bar{width:6px;height:60px;min-width:6px;border-radius:12px}.proc-col-id{width:168px;min-width:168px}.proc-col-clinic{width:200px;min-width:200px;text-align:center}.proc-col-type,.proc-col-date{width:120px;min-width:120px;text-align:center}.proc-col-status{width:110px;min-width:110px;text-align:center}.proc-col-updated{width:120px;min-width:120px;text-align:center}.proc-no-name{color:var(--500);font-style:italic}.proc-uppercase{font-size:12px;text-transform:uppercase;letter-spacing:.96px;line-height:24px}.proc-empty{padding:48px 16px;text-align:center}.proc-pagination{display:flex;align-items:center;justify-content:center;gap:16px;padding:8px 0}.proc-page-btn{border:1px solid var(--200);background:var(--150);border-radius:8px;padding:8px 16px;cursor:pointer;color:var(--900)}.proc-page-btn:disabled{opacity:.5;cursor:not-allowed}.status-pill{display:inline-flex;align-items:center;gap:6px;height:26px;padding:0 10px;border:1px solid var(--300);border-radius:8px;background:var(--100);color:var(--Principal-Black)}.status-pill>span{line-height:1}.status-dot{width:8px;height:8px;min-width:8px;border-radius:50%}.status-pending{background:var(--Secondary-New-Yellow)}.status-ended{background:var(--Principal-Encode-Green)}.proc-detail{width:520px;flex-shrink:0;align-self:stretch;display:flex;flex-direction:column;background:var(--100);border:1px solid var(--200);border-radius:4px;overflow:hidden}.proc-detail-header{display:flex;align-items:flex-start;justify-content:space-between;gap:12px;padding:24px;border-bottom:1px solid var(--200)}.proc-detail-header--signed{background:var(--Principal-Encode-Green);border-bottom-color:transparent}.proc-detail-title{display:flex;flex-direction:column;gap:2px;min-width:0}.proc-detail-title-text{margin:0;color:var(--1100)}.proc-detail-header--signed .proc-detail-title-text{color:var(--100)}.proc-detail-id{margin:0;font-size:12px;line-height:18px;color:var(--700);text-transform:uppercase;letter-spacing:.96px;word-break:break-all}.proc-detail-header--signed .proc-detail-id{color:#ffffffd9}.proc-detail-header-right{display:flex;align-items:center;gap:12px;flex-shrink:0}.proc-detail-close{border:none;background:transparent;color:var(--600);font-size:22px;line-height:1;cursor:pointer;padding:0 4px}.proc-detail-close:hover{color:var(--900)}.proc-detail-header--signed .proc-detail-close{color:var(--100)}.proc-detail-header--signed .proc-detail-close:hover{color:#fffc}.proc-detail-signed-bar{display:flex;align-items:center;gap:12px;padding:12px 24px;background:#206fcb14}.proc-detail-signed-eye{flex-shrink:0;width:32px;height:32px;border-radius:50%;border:none;background:#206fcb1f;color:var(--Principal-Encode-Green);display:flex;align-items:center;justify-content:center;cursor:pointer}.proc-detail-signed-eye:hover{background:#206fcb33}.proc-detail-signed-field{display:flex;flex-direction:column;min-width:0}.proc-detail-signed-label{font-size:12px;line-height:20px;text-transform:uppercase;letter-spacing:.96px;color:var(--Principal-Encode-Green)}.proc-detail-signed-spacer{flex:1}.proc-detail-signed-check{flex-shrink:0;display:flex;align-items:center}.proc-detail-loading{flex:1;min-height:240px;position:relative}.proc-detail-error{flex:1;display:flex;align-items:center;justify-content:center;padding:48px 24px;text-align:center}.proc-detail-content{flex:1;overflow-y:auto;padding:24px}.proc-detail-section-title{margin:0 0 12px;font-size:12px;line-height:24px;color:var(--1100);text-transform:uppercase;letter-spacing:.96px}.proc-detail-grid{display:grid;grid-template-columns:repeat(2,minmax(0,1fr));gap:20px 32px}.proc-detail-field{display:flex;flex-direction:column;gap:4px;min-width:0}.proc-detail-label{font-size:12px;line-height:24px;color:var(--700);text-transform:uppercase;letter-spacing:.96px}.proc-detail-footer{padding:24px;border-top:1px solid var(--200);background:var(--150)}.proc-detail-footer--payment{display:flex;flex-direction:row;gap:12px}.proc-detail-payment-btn{flex:1;height:45px;padding:8px 20px;border-radius:12px;border:1px solid transparent;cursor:pointer}.proc-detail-payment-btn--accept{background:#c8e6d2;border-color:#7fbf95;color:var(--Principal-Encode-Green)}.proc-detail-payment-btn--accept:hover{background:#b8ddc4}.proc-detail-payment-btn--deny{background:#f7d2d2;border-color:#e09a9a;color:var(--Secondary-Red)}.proc-detail-payment-btn--deny:hover{background:#f2c2c2}
